NOTES AND MEMORANDA.

The X.Z. Loan and Mercantile Agency. Co., Ltd., draw the attention of their clients to their autumn bullock and cattle fair, which they are holding in their Kohuratabi yards on Thursday, 30th inst. Full particulars will be found in our advertising columns on page 8 of this issue. Messrs Matthews. Gamlin and Co., will sell on Wednesday. March 29th, the whole of Mr E. Vickers' Hampshire Down sheep, Air -Tickers having leased his farm. Newton King's Fohokura Snpptementarv Sheep Fair takes place on Wednesday, March 29th. Particulars appear; in another column, Particulars of Newton King's Stratfor stock sale, which takes place on Tuesday next, Marcn 28th, appear elsewhere. On Saturday, April 15th, at 2 p.m., the New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Company Ltd., will sell at their Auction Rooms, Stratford, ecutain lands as set out in another column, bv order of the mortgagee under conduct of the Registrar of the Supreme Court. At their Kohuratabi Sale announced elsewhere, the N.Z.L. and M. Agency, instructed by Mr F. H. Symoiis, who is leaving the district, | will sell sheep and cattle as detailed in another column.
